As a public body within the meaning of Directive (EU) 2016/2102, we strive to make our website accessible in accordance with the provisions of the Brandenburg Equal Opportunities for Persons with Disabilities Act (BbgBGG) and the Brandenburg Accessible Information Technology Ordinance (BbgBITV) implementing Directive (EU) 2016/2102.

According to § 2 BbgBITV, websites and apps are presumed to be accessible if they meet the requirements of the harmonised European Standard (EN) 301 549 (in its current version). EN 301 549 refers to the requirements of the international Web Content Accessibility Guidelines, version 2.1 (WCAG 2.1), Levels A and AA. These requirements form the basis of the testable success criteria.

Feedback process

If you do not receive a satisfactory response, or any response at all, within three weeks using the contact options mentioned above, you may contact the Enforcement Office for Digital Accessibility of the State of Brandenburg. The office will review the information and measures stated in the accessibility declaration. According to § 4 (3) BbgBITV, the Enforcement Office is responsible for upholding the right of citizens to barrier-free websites and mobile applications provided by public bodies of the State of Brandenburg. The Enforcement Office examines, from both a formal and substantive perspective, whether an enforcement procedure is applicable and may, in individual cases, request a technical review of the website or mobile application by the Monitoring Body for the Accessibility of Web and Application Technologies in the State of Brandenburg. The enforcement procedure is free of charge. No legal counsel is required.

Emergency exit & erasure of digital traces

Click the “Emergency Exit” button at the top right corner of the website to leave our website immediately and be redirected to the Google homepage. If someone you feel threatened by has access to the device you are using, you can use this guide to erase your digital traces after leaving the website.
